Abstract: The notion of a key concept is proposed in decision formal contexts. The conditional attributes of a decision formal context is classified into necessary and unnecessary categories, and the theorem of justifying whether or not a given conditional attribute is necessary is derived. A heuristic attribute reduction algorithm is developed in decision formal contexts and a real example is used to demonstrate its feasibility and effectiveness.
